#691610 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#691610 is composed of 41.2% red, 8.6%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 79% magenta, 84.8% yellow and 58.8% black. It has a hue angle of 4 degrees, a saturation of 73.6% and a lightness of 23.7%. #691610 color hex could be obtained by blending #d22c20 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

Shades and Tints of #691610

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030100 is the darkest color, while #fdf2f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#691610

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3f3a3a is the less saturated color, while #770a02 is the most saturated one.
